A Little on the Region
They say that Umbria is the "Green Heart" of Italy - largely due to its location (the middle), shape (more or less a heart shape after a couple bottles of wine) and the color (rolling fields of green among forests). It's a lovely place, there is no denying this. But where to go? What to do? You are within a very close driving distace between Todi and Orvieto - bit with their own appeal and restaurants. May we suggest Perugia for its shopping, international ambience and film houses; Orvieto for its fabulous duomo and antiquities, Deruta for its ceramics, Assisi for the spiritual awakening and Todi for its art, ambience and antiquity. Nearby the small hamlets of Morre, Collelungo and Moruzze will have a couple of small grocery shops. But the real stuff is further afield.
